Martin Rapier08 Jan 2009 9:44 a.m. PST

"a good set of rules "

Depends what size of game you are interested in, my personal preference is for division/corps sized for which Great War Spearhead is fine. Other decent sets are Over the Top and Square Bashing. You can play these with any sort of figures from 2mm to 54mm if you wish. They work fine for Eastern Front and have TO&Es for Russian forces.

If you want to do skirmishes though, other people will have better advice.
